The big void in the southwest corner of the Webb image isn't even noticable in the Hubble image. What's going on there?
--

Drew
New Probably a dust bubble surrounding the entire galaxy
Webb sees through dust, Hubble does not. The dust scatters the visible light coming from below and blows out the void in the Hubble image.
